javascript - 聚合物 : paper-autocomplete set value

标签 javascript autocomplete polymer-1.0 paper-elements

我在 <paper-card> 中有一个 paper 自动完成元素,如下所示

<paper-autocomplete label="Select HWName" 
                    id="HWName" 
                    on-autocomplete-selected="onDeviceSelect" 
                    no-label-float="true"></paper-autocomplete> 

在给定的 html 文件中。我从另一个文件访问它,如下

var hwName = document.querySelector("#HWName");

我需要能够在刷新时在其输入区域中设置一些值,我记得使用 localStorage API。我尝试使用

 hwName.value = "test" 
         or 
 hwName.label = "test" 

但它不起作用。甚至尝试使用 setOption(option)如上所述here但不起作用。

是否可以在 paper-autocomplete 上显示一些值元素?我不想输入,它应该只设置最后一个值。

最佳答案

您需要设置paper-autocompletetext属性。

所以你的代码将是这样的

 hwName.text = "test"

关于javascript - 聚合物 : paper-autocomplete set value,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/42922838/

相关文章:

javascript - react native : Create component error

jquery - Grails richui 自动完成克隆文本框

behavior - 如何在 Polymer 1.0 中调用默认行为的方法?

authentication - polymer 1.0 : How to design a modern authentication UX in Polymer if modals must go outside <paper-drawer-panel>?

数据事件的 JavaScript 选择器?

javascript - 在窗口底部固定 div 但保持在页脚上方并在页面宽度上触发的更简洁的方法

jquery - yii2 依赖的自动完成小部件

javascript - 如何将 jQuery 自动完成插件用于链接的输入字段?

debugging - 如何调试 Polymer 项目 1.x?

javascript - 为什么 React useState 返回常量数组